TRANSFER OF FIREARMS: All Wisconsin residents that purchase non-antique firearms (as defined by the BATFE) and all nonresidents that purchase non-antique long guns and intend to take possession of their firearms purchases at Bennett Auction Service, 700 Main Street, Prentice, Wisconsin must first successfully complete an ATF Form 4473 and must not be denied by either a NICS background check or WI Handgun Hotline background check, as applicable. Face-to-face transfers of non-antique handguns to WI residents also require a two day waiting period before transfer. Alternately, non-antique firearms may be shipped to a Federal Firearms License (FFL) holder for legal transfer to the purchaser. Please provide us with a signed copy of the FFL holder's license (by postal mail or email) that will be handling the transfer, and we will ship the firearm(s) to the licensee. We cannot ship non-antique handguns or long guns directly to purchasers, nor will we ship firearms out of the United States. All firearms that enter or exit our facility must be unloaded and in a locked case, as we are within 1,000 feet of a School Zone.
